A GREAT STRIKE.
FIFTY TOUSAND MACHINISTS. By Telegraph—Press Association—Copyright New York, May 21. Fifty thousand machinists in the United States have struck, demanding ten hours’ pay foiyiine hours’ work. The employers’ concessions prevented the strike spreading to 150,000 workers.
